Why we exist

Friends kept forwarding screenshot APRs from chat groups. The numbers looked neat; the assumptions underneath rarely survived a second look. Orchestrate API Digital started as a quiet desk in Causeway Bay where we rebuilt those figures on a PC calculator with visible inputs — lock-up length, validator commission, compounding — so people could decide with eyes open.

We are not a brokerage, not a fund, and not a custody shop. We prepare staking reward estimates and teach clients how to re-run them.

How we work

Sessions stay deliberately small. One client, one workstation, current network parameters. We write down every assumption we dial into the Smart Crypto Calculator PC. If a figure is uncertain, we say so and show a range instead of a single heroic percentage.
